What is Fiber Network?

Fiber Network is an advanced public lightning network built on the CKB blockchain, utilizing off-chain channels to facilitate fast, low-cost, and decentralized payments. This innovative network supports multi-currency transactions, enabling P2P exchanges with unprecedented efficiency. The Fiber Network has recently launched a basic beta version for developers, which can create, update, and close channels between two nodes. It also supports the establishment of RGB++ Coin channels and ensures cross-chain interoperability with the Bitcoin Lightning Network, enhancing its utility and versatility.

How Does Fiber Network Improve Lightning Payments?

Fiber Network significantly improves lightning payments by leveraging the robust infrastructure of the CKB blockchain and integrating off-chain channels. This setup allows for instantaneous transactions with minimal fees, making it ideal for small, frequent payments that would otherwise be inefficient on traditional blockchain networks. The current beta version allows developers to test the network's core functionalities, such as creating and managing payment channels between nodes. By supporting multi-currency transactions, including Bitcoin through cross-chain interoperability, Fiber Network opens up new possibilities for decentralized finance and broadens the scope of lightning network applications.

How Does Fiber Network Support Multi-Hop Routing and Monitoring Services?

With the complete beta version of Fiber Network set to release in mid-September, the network will introduce support for multi-hop routing and monitoring services. Multi-hop routing allows payments to be routed across multiple nodes, ensuring that transactions can be completed even if a direct channel between two parties does not exist. This feature enhances the network's scalability and reliability, making it a more robust solution for decentralized transactions. Additionally, monitoring services will enable users to keep track of their transactions and network health, providing an extra layer of transparency and security.

What Are the Potential Applications of Fiber Network?

Fiber Network has the potential to revolutionize various sectors by enabling decentralized multi-currency payments and P2P transactions. Its applications could range from everyday micropayments, such as buying a cup of coffee with cryptocurrency, to more complex financial operations, such as cross-border transfers and remittances. Businesses could also leverage Fiber Network to streamline payments, reduce costs, and enhance customer experiences.

The network's cross-chain interoperability with Bitcoin Lightning Network makes it particularly appealing to Bitcoin users, offering them a seamless way to engage with decentralized finance without sacrificing speed or cost-efficiency.
